The Sociedad de Promoción Exterior Principado de Asturias S.A. (Asturex) is undertaking a series of activities, such as direct and visiting trade missions and contact between Asturian and North American companies, which are framed within an internationalisation drive strategy focusing on commercial sphere programmes with the State of Texas.
Commercial activities with Texas, that began in February and March with direct missions from Asturian companies in the metal, ICT and construction sectors to the USA, intensified throughout the month of May.
Visiting Trade Mission with Jacobs
On 11th and 12th May an inverse trade capture mission was undertaken with the US engineering company Jacobs. The action targeted Asturian companies that are presented as potential suppliers for the multinational.
For this meeting, Asturex studied the companies that were interested in meeting with Jacobs and selected a series of companies that attended meetings with Jacobs. During this visit from the multinational’s Purchasing Manager and Quality Manager, IDEPA gave a presentation to promote the competitive advantages of Asturias.
Direct Trade Mission to Texas
Asturex has planned the organisation of a direct trade mission to Texas for the end of September 2016; an activity framed within the business opportunities programme strategy in this US state.
Jacobs, the multinational with its headquarters in Pasadena, California, is present in over 30 countries with its network of 250 offices and a turnover of over 12,000 million dollars. Its activity centres on undertaking feasibility and environmental impact studies, and it is present in sectors such as aerospace, automotive industry, construction and telecommunications, amongst others.
